From O’Neill surfboards in California to Ben & Jerry’s ice cream in Vermont, and Ford trucks out of Michigan, some products are stitched so tightly into their home state’s identity that they’re practically part of the local flag. But which North Carolina-made goods inspire the most pride today?
That’s the question MarketBeat.com, a leading financial media company, set out to answer. Surveying 3,015 respondents, they asked North Carolinians to name the products that make them beam with state pride. The results were as follows:
#1 Krispy Kreme Doughnuts (Winston-Salem) Iconic glazed doughnuts with a “Hot Now” sign that draws crowds. North Carolinians beam with pride knowing their hometown treat still makes people pull U-turns for a warm dozen.
